The transcript explores themes of indecision and searching for the right partner. It highlights the struggle of making decisions in relationships and the desire for clarity and unity. The recurring motif of 'eenie, meenie, miney, mo' symbolizes the indecisiveness and the hope for a harmonious connection. The narrative emphasizes the importance of not wasting time and finding resolution in love.
